Boullier confident McLaren can fight for wins
McLaren-Mercedes
McLaren racing director Eric Boullier says his team has to believe that they can stand on top of the podium once again in 2014.
McLaren left the first round of the season in the lead of the constructors' championship but failed to score points in Bahrain or in China, with both Jenson Button and Kevin Magnussen finishing outside of the top 10 last weekend.
McLaren has not won a race since the end of the 2012 season.
"We have to believe we will win a race," he told a McLaren teleconference. "I think we will be able to keep pushing to bring a very strong and aggressive development for the season. I think we put ourselves in a position to fight for a win - maybe...
